Electrolux Had a Strong Quarter, But Progress in North America Needed -- Market Talk
Dow Jones2026/07/30 10:421042 GMT - Electrolux reported a stronger-than-expected second quarter thanks to strong organic sales growth and operating margin improvement in most regions, while North America remains challenging, AlphaValue analyst Helene Coumes writes. The Swedish appliance maker's earnings were supported by significant cost savings, while non-recurring costs related to the company's Midea Group partnership impacted reported results, Coumes adds. Electrolux and Midea formed a long-term strategic partnership in North America to cut costs, optimize manufacturing and boost product development. "The share price reacted positively, but further upside will depend on the successful execution of this partnership and the recovery of the North American operations." Shares fall 2.4% after rising 22% Wednesday. (dominic.chopping@wsj.com)
